Kakkiralapalli - Inavole, Hanumakonda
Kakkiralapalli is a village situated in the Inavole mandal of Hanumakonda district, Telangana. It is located approximately 15 km from Wardhannapet and around 15 km from Warangal. Kakkiralapalle serves as the Gram Panchayat for Kakkiralapalli village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Kakkiralapalli is 578312. The village covers a total geographical area of 1524 hectares and falls under the 506313 pincode. Warangal is the nearest town, located about 15 km away.
Kakkiralapalli village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Kakkiralapalli
As per Census 2011, Kakkiralapalli village has a total population of 2,877 people, consisting of 1,442 males and 1,435 females. The village has 765 households and a sex ratio of 995 females per 1,000 males. There are 295 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 1,546 literate and 1,331 illiterate residents. Additionally, 988 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 10 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Kakkiralapalli are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 2,877 | 1,442 | 1,435 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 295 | 148 | 147 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 988 | 505 | 483 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 10 | 5 | 5 |
| Literate Population | 1,546 | 903 | 643 |
| Illiterate Population | 1,331 | 539 | 792 |

Transport and Connectivity of Kakkiralapalli
Kakkiralapalli is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Warangal to Kakkiralapalli is about 15 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Kakkiralapalli
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Kakkiralapalli village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| ATM | Yes | Available within village |
| Post Office | Yes | Available within village |
Health Facilities in Kakkiralapalli
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Kakkiralapalli village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
